In this position you will be working on low-power RF communication circuits and IoT devices using state-of-the art process technology. You will be creating specific circuitry for modulation and demodulation of information into RF signals as well as other aspects related to low power radio communication.


Your responsibilities will include RTL coding simulation synthesis verification and debugging of communication chips both at the circuit level and behavioral will be able to define and test new modulation and demodulation algorithms for different modulation formats like BPSK FSK QAM and OFDM. You will develop those algorithms using low-level embedded assembler-programmed CPUs. You will participate in the development of new low-power architectures for future products.

This position involves routine communication with a highly talented team of analog and digital design engineers to solve problems and present information as well as active participation in work groups providing ideas and collaborative teamwork.



Qualifications

Minimum requirements:

  • Master Degree in Electronics Engineering Telecommunication Engineering or related field.
  • Good knowledge of communication theory and digital signal processing
  • Understanding of digital logic design
  • Familiarity with the Verilog and VHDL language and simulators
  • Strong programming skills: Matlab C Python and Assembler
  • Understanding of analog and RF electronics and exposure to analog IC design methods
  • Excellent communication skills in English
